Agreement Concluded Between Afghan, Hamdan Of Iran Chamber Of Commerce

Saturday, January 21, 2012
Kabul (BNA) An agreement of cooperation signed between the chambers of commerce of Afghanistan and the Hamdan of Iran in Kabul. 
On the basis of this agreement exchanges of commercial delegations will be exchanged, joint chamber of commerce will be established in Kabul and Hamdan of Iran, trade relations will be expanded, and that trade exhibitions will be organized in Kabul and Hamdan as well as trade goods and the products of Hamdan to Kabul and that of Kabul to Hamdan will be exchanged.  
The agreement was signed by Rahimullah Head of Board of Directors of Kabul Chambers of Commerce and Industries and chairman of the Chamber of Commerce and Industries of Hamdan of Iran. 
Mohammad Qurban Haqjo Executive Head of Board of Directors of Chambers of Commerce and Industries said at the ceremony that we welcome the expansion of trade ties especially the interest taken by the Iranian traders in exporting of Afghan products to Iran and the Iranian investment in Afghanistan. 
The Iranian embassy trade attaché in Kabul said that his embassy in Kabul will issue trade visa for the Afghan traders. 
The Iranian exports to Afghanistan in 1389 have been recorded at 1.3 billion US dollars while Afghan exports indicate USD 32 million.
